Before you give a speech, prepare a series of talking points that contain the key messages you want your audience to know, feel, and understand by the time you have finished speaking. One of the best ways to open your speech with a buzz is to startle or shock them. You can shock an audience in many ways, but they all rest on the major senses of Visual, Auditory, Kinesthetic (touch) and Smell (VAKS). We don’t want your audience tasting your talk, but it should leave a good taste in their mouths.
